Design patterns for constructing resilient relayer networks facilitating cross-chain communications reliably.
A practical, evergreen exploration of robust relayer network design, detailing patterns that ensure cross-chain messages travel smoothly, securely, and with low latency across evolving blockchain ecosystems.
Published July 18, 2025
Facebook X Reddit Pinterest Email
Relayer networks play a pivotal role in cross-chain compatibility, acting as the connective tissue that transfers data and value between disparate blockchain environments. The most durable designs emphasize modularity, clear responsibility boundaries, and observable state. Start with a simple broker pattern that abstracts the transport layer so that upgrades or migrations do not disrupt end-to-end messaging. Consider decomposing relayers into distinct components: a session manager, a message queue, and a verifier. Each module should expose stable interfaces, enabling independent testing and future enhancements. Additionally, implement thorough sequencing to guarantee ordered delivery, while preserving idempotence so duplicate events do not corrupt state across chains.
A resilient relay system must cope with network fluctuations, validator churn, and occasional misbehaviors without collapsing. Designing for fault tolerance begins with redundancy: deploy multiple, geographically diverse relayer instances that can take over when one path becomes unavailable. Leverage consistent hashing to balance load and reduce hot spots, ensuring that the same messages land on predictable relayers across restarts. Introduce a heartbeat mechanism to monitor liveness and a retry policy that avoids backoffs becoming prohibitive under transient congestion. Finally, publish cryptographic proofs alongside messages so recipients can verify integrity even when some relayers deviate from expected behavior.
Techniques to improve reliability and performance
One core pattern is the asynchronous relay with feedback loops. Messages are queued at the source chain, then asynchronously propagated through a network of relayers. Each relayer adds a lightweight, verifiable signature and a timestamp, enabling receivers to validate provenance and ordering. The feedback loop confirms receipt, allowing the originator to detect failures and trigger compensating actions, such as redelivery or alternate routing. This approach decouples sending from confirmation, keeping latency low while preserving reliability. To prevent congestion, implement back-pressure signals that throttle submission rates when queues grow too large or when validators report excessive delays.
ADVERTISEMENT
ADVERTISEMENT
Another essential pattern is verifiable off-chain state proofs. For cross-chain operations, relayers should attach succinct proofs that the target chain can verify with minimal computation. Such proofs reduce trust assumptions and lessen the burden on validators by providing compact evidence of state changes, Oracle attestations, or bridge events. The architecture should support optional, privacy-preserving proofs for sensitive data, using zero-knowledge techniques where appropriate. Emphasize standardized proof formats to enable interoperability across different blockchain families. When proofs are standardized, tooling becomes reusable, and the ecosystem benefits from faster integration cycles and fewer bespoke solutions.
Patterns that reduce complexity and improve maintainability
Latency is a crucial consideration, but reliability must not be sacrificed to chase speed. A robust relayer network employs tiered routing: local edge relayers handle time-sensitive messages, while regional hubs consolidate traffic and optimize cross-border paths. This division reduces single-point delays and isolates failures to smaller segments of the network. Ensure that each tier can operate independently if others are compromised, with clear fallback routes that preserve delivery guarantees. In addition, implement adaptive timeout policies that adjust to observed network conditions, preventing premature retries that would waste resources during congestion.
ADVERTISEMENT
ADVERTISEMENT
Security and governance underpin trust in cross-chain messaging. A sound design uses cryptographic signing, multi-party approvals where appropriate, and transparent auditing of relayer behavior. Access controls restrict who can publish, reroute, or cancel messages, while event logs are immutable and time-stamped for traceability. Governance should include mechanisms for updating routing policies, revocation lists, and upgrade paths without triggering disruption. Finally, adopt a layered defense strategy: network-level protections such as firewalling and rate limiting, combined with application-level verifications that reject mismatched proofs or invalid state transitions.
Methods to ensure robustness under diverse conditions
A clean architectural boundary between the relayer network and application logic reduces complexity and accelerates adoption. Define a standard API for message envelopes that encapsulate payloads, routing hints, and proofs, while leaving implementation details to individual relayers. This separation allows developers to implement disease-resistant, testable modules without being forced into a single framework. Emphasize simulation and stubbing in development, enabling teams to validate corner cases, such as network partitions or out-of-order deliveries, before live deployment. Documentation should cover not only how to use the API but why routing decisions were made, aiding future maintenance and governance.
Observability and instrumentation are non-negotiable for evergreen resilience. Instrument relayer metrics with meaningful granularity: per-message latency, queue depth, success rates, and proof validation times. Correlate these with system logs to produce actionable insights during incidents. Dashboards should present real-time health indicators and historical trends to help operators anticipate capacity issues. Implement tracing that spans the entire cross-chain journey, failing gracefully when tracing information reveals misrouting or fraud indicators. Regularly run chaos experiments to validate recovery plans and ensure the system can regain steady state after perturbations.
ADVERTISEMENT
ADVERTISEMENT
Designing for future-proof cross-chain ecosystems
Interoperability should be treated as a first-class concern. Support a broad set of cross-chain capabilities, including value transfers, event notifications, and data embedding, while keeping the core relay logic adaptable. Use a pluggable architecture to support different cryptographic schemes, consensus models, and relay transports. This flexibility reduces the risk of vendor lock-in and ensures longer lifespans as technologies evolve. The design should also advocate for backward compatibility, enabling a gradual migration path for networks as they upgrade. By avoiding disruptive, monolithic changes, ecosystems remain stable and resilient across versions.
Recovery strategies must be explicit and rehearsed. Build playbooks that describe step-by-step actions for common failure modes: component crashes, chain reorgs, or network partitions. Automate as many recovery steps as possible, with clear escalation paths and rollback mechanisms. Preserve a consistent snapshot of state so that, after disruption, relayers can resume processing without duplicating messages or violating ordering. Regularly test disaster scenarios with simulated cross-chain traffic and measure recovery times. The goal is to minimize data loss, maximize availability, and maintain integrity across all participating networks.
Finally, embrace evolution as a core principle. Relayer networks must adapt to new workloads, evolving consensus rules, and changing regulatory environments. Build toward modular upgrades that allow components to be swapped without tearing apart the whole system. Foster a culture of collaboration among different blockchain teams, standardizing interface definitions, proof formats, and routing semantics. By prioritizing interoperability and openness, the network becomes more resilient to individual project failures and better prepared to absorb innovations such as sharding, layer-two scaling, or cross-chain identity.
As cross-chain communications become more prevalent, the architectural choices described here help ensure reliability, security, and performance. The strongest patterns emphasize modularity, verifiable proofs, robust observability, and flexible routing. When these elements are combined, relayers can withstand operational pressures, accommodate growth, and deliver trustworthy cross-chain interactions. The result is an ecosystem where developers, operators, and users gain confidence in interconnected blockchain services, knowing that messages traverse networks with integrity and predictability, even as technology evolves.
Related Articles
Blockchain infrastructure
This evergreen exploration outlines robust strategies for orchestrating distributed key generation ceremonies, emphasizing auditable processes, verifiable participant checks, transparent governance, and secure, scalable implementations across diverse environments.
-
July 16, 2025
Blockchain infrastructure
In permissioned blockchains, engineers seek patterns that preserve decentralization ethos while optimizing performance, governance, and reliability. This evergreen guide explores scalable design choices, governance models, and practical tradeoffs that help teams align security, speed, and transparency without sacrificing inclusivity or resilience.
-
August 07, 2025
Blockchain infrastructure
Deterministic replay in blockchain auditing demands robust, reproducible methodologies that ensure identical state reconstruction, transparent event sequencing, and verifiable outcomes, empowering auditors and dispute resolvers with confidence and speed.
-
July 23, 2025
Blockchain infrastructure
This evergreen guide explores practical design patterns enabling modular, extensible node plugins, empowering ecosystem developers to extend client capabilities without sacrificing performance, security, or interoperability across diverse blockchain environments.
-
July 25, 2025
Blockchain infrastructure
Distributed ledgers demand robust replication strategies across continents; this guide outlines practical, scalable approaches to maintain consistency, availability, and performance during network partitions and data-center outages.
-
July 24, 2025
Blockchain infrastructure
This evergreen guide explores a principled approach to provable data retention, aligning regulatory compliance with decentralization ideals, cryptographic proofs, governance structures, and resilient storage across distributed networks.
-
August 08, 2025
Blockchain infrastructure
This article explains practical design principles, user interactions, and security engineering strategies for creating staking delegation interfaces that are approachable for non-technical token holders while maintaining robust protections and verifiable trust.
-
July 18, 2025
Blockchain infrastructure
A comprehensive exploration of how hardware-backed attestation can strengthen node identity, enforce network permissioning, and enhance trust across distributed systems by outlining architectures, processes, and governance considerations for real-world deployments.
-
July 15, 2025
Blockchain infrastructure
In decentralized timestamping, multiple independent attestors coordinate to securely record, verify, and immortalize digital events, ensuring verifiable proofs that resist single-point failures and manipulation. This article examines scalable architectures, governance patterns, cryptographic techniques, and operational safeguards that enable robust, auditable timestamping across distributed networks.
-
July 21, 2025
Blockchain infrastructure
This evergreen guide explores how standardizing edge-case handling and clarifying ambiguous specifications can substantially reduce cross-client consensus drift, improving interoperability, reliability, and safety across distributed ledger ecosystems.
-
July 26, 2025
Blockchain infrastructure
A practical guide detailing rigorous verification strategies for bridge recovery plans, outlining audits, simulations, governance checks, and continuous improvements to safeguard digital assets during adverse events.
-
July 19, 2025
Blockchain infrastructure
As blockchain ecosystems mature, diverse strategies emerge for upgrading protocols and executing hard forks with reduced disruption, balancing governance, security, and incentives to keep participants aligned through transition.
-
August 11, 2025
Blockchain infrastructure
This evergreen guide explores robust patterns for upgrading onchain modules, emphasizing security, composability, and reliable rollback mechanisms to protect users while enabling seamless evolution of smart contracts.
-
July 19, 2025
Blockchain infrastructure
A comprehensive exploration of governance frameworks that balance technical excellence, diverse stakeholder interests, and transparent decision making to steward seismic protocol upgrades.
-
July 28, 2025
Blockchain infrastructure
This article explores architectural strategies for building scalable event indexing layers that power real-time data flow in decentralized applications, addressing throughput, latency, consistency, and fault tolerance across distributed networks.
-
August 08, 2025
Blockchain infrastructure
Fee estimation is a critical pillar in distributed networks, demanding adaptive models that respond to workload shifts, network congestion, and user expectations. This evergreen guide explores principled strategies for creating resilient estimators, blending statistical rigor with practical engineering, so applications can anticipate costs, manage risk, and scale without sacrificing performance or user trust.
-
July 25, 2025
Blockchain infrastructure
As network conditions fluctuate and maintenance windows appear, organizations can design systems to gracefully degrade, preserving core functionality, maintaining user trust, and reducing incident impact through deliberate architecture choices and responsive operational practices.
-
July 14, 2025
Blockchain infrastructure
A practical exploration of lightweight verification techniques through robust checkpointing that preserves security, reduces bandwidth, and accelerates trustless validation for resource-constrained nodes across evolving blockchain ecosystems.
-
August 12, 2025
Blockchain infrastructure
This article examines robust strategies for upgrading light clients in distributed systems, focusing on provable safety when proof formats evolve, ensuring seamless transitions, verification integrity, and long-term stability for networks.
-
July 16, 2025
Blockchain infrastructure
An evergreen survey of techniques that securely bind offchain state roots into onchain commitments, enabling reliable cross-chain proofs, auditability, and durable interoperability across diverse blockchain architectures worldwide ecosystems.
-
July 18, 2025